Medical Dictionary

supratrochlear artery

noun su·pra·troch·le·ar artery \-ˌträk-lē-ər-\

Medical Definition of supratrochlear artery

  1. :  one of the terminal branches of the ophthalmic artery that ascends upon the forehead from the inner angle of the orbit—called also frontal artery

